- End 19th Century Antique Magnetic Topographic Compass Made in Brass and OakLocated in Milan, ITMagnetic topographic compass, of oak and brass; instrument consisting of a magnetized needle free to rotate on a horizontal plane, marking with the tip of the needle the direction of magnetic north, compass card with eight winds complete with goniometric circle divided into 360 °, complete with the compass needle lock. Italian manufacture of the late 19th century. Very good condition. Measure 3.1x3.1 height 1. Shipping is insured by Lloyd's London; our gift box is free (look at the last picture).
